6.1.4 Using PCF2131-ARD with another Arduino device
The PCF2131-ARD daughterboard can be operated with a different EVK board, which
has an Arduino port. There are two options to connect the board: using an EVK equipped
with an Arduino port, and an EVK without an Arduino port. In the first case, a firmware
shall be developed according with PCF2131TF specifications, and then simply attach
PCF2131-ARD daughterboard to the EVK, to operate the board. In the second case,
using the pin chart of Arduino connectors (
), make the necessary electrical
connections (for power, I
2
C-bus or SPI-bus and interrupt control lines), and develop the
desired firmware, assuring that is compliant with IC specifications. Use PCF2131TF
datasheet to read details about internal registers of PCF2131TF and data exchange
between internal controller and the EVK. Ensure the electrical connections are correct
and avoid data conflicts on the signal lines to prevent IC damage.
6.1.5 Using PCF2131-ARD with Aardvark I
2
C/SPI Host Adapter
The PCF2131-ARD evaluation board can be controlled with the Aardvark I
2
C/SPI host
adapter from Total Phase. The daughterboard contains the dedicated Aardvark connector
(J4), so the host adapter can be directly connected to the daughterboard through J4
header, as shown in
. The pin chart of J4 is detailed in
. The Aardvark
I
2
C/SPI host adapter, along with the software tools (dynamic linked library, control
center API) from Total Phase represents a powerful tool to test and develop devices and
systems which use I
2
C and SPI standard protocols.
Note: The user must provide power through the USB connector (J5), or Arduino interface
(J11), before operating the daughterboard with the Aardvark host adapter. In
the power is provided through the USB connector.
